The DNA molecule is a polymer of nucleotides. Each nucleotide is composed of a nitrogenous base, a five-carbon sugar (deoxyribose), and a phosphate group. There are four nitrogenous bases in DNA, two purines (adenine and guanine) and two pyrimidines (cytosine and thymine). A DNA molecule is composed of two strands.

WHAT ARE NUCLEOTIDES?
- Nucleotides are monomeric units of nucleic acids such as DNA and RNA. Nucleotides that form the DNA molecule are made up of three components namely: nitrogenous bases (A, C, G, T), phosphate group, and deoxyribose sugar.
- DNA molecule is formed when nucleotides come together to form hydrogen bonds between adjacent nitrogenous bases.
- Adenine pairs with Thymine while Guanine pairs with Cytosine in the DNA molecule via hydrogen bonds.
- However, the double strand of DNA is formed when the sugar and phosphate group bonds with the aid of a bond called phosphodiester bond.
